Local Weather Risks in Houston
Triggers
Severe thunderstorms with high winds, hail, and heavy rainfall are common triggers. Straight-line winds can tear off shingles and flashing, while hail can create multiple punctures. Prolonged rainfall following damage accelerates water intrusion.
Seasonal Risks
In Houston, AL and surrounding Winston County, roofing emergencies often spike during spring and fall storm seasons. Late winter ice storms and summer thunderstorms also create significant roof damage risks throughout the year.
Disaster Scenarios
After major storms, widespread roof damage often occurs across neighborhoods. Fallen trees and limbs can puncture roofs, while wind-driven rain finds weaknesses in damaged areas. Freezing conditions can create ice dams that force water under shingles and into structures.
Common Emergency Response Process
When you contact emergency roofing services in Houston, AL, qualified providers follow a systematic approach:
Immediate Assessment: A local professional will discuss your situation by phone to determine urgency level and provide initial safety guidance.
Temporary Protection: For active emergencies, providers can often dispatch crews to install tarps or temporary coverings to prevent further water damage.
Damage Evaluation: Once secured, a thorough inspection identifies all damage points, structural concerns, and necessary repairs.
Repair Coordination: Licensed contractors provide detailed repair plans, work with insurance when applicable, and schedule permanent repairs.
Emergency responders prioritize safety first, then property protection, followed by permanent restoration.
Emergency Prevention Tips
- ✓ Schedule annual roof inspections, especially before storm seasons
- ✓ Keep trees trimmed back from roof lines to prevent limb damage
- ✓ Clear gutters and downspouts regularly to prevent water backup
- ✓ Check attic ventilation to reduce ice dam formation in winter
- ✓ Document your roof's condition with photos for insurance purposes
- ✓ Address minor repairs promptly before they become emergencies
